Use of the Black Pearl Mail Services is subject to this Acceptable Use Policy ("AUP"). If not defined here, capitalized terms have the meaning stated in the applicable contract ("Agreement") between customer, reseller or other authorized user ("You") and Black Pearl Mail (“BPM”).  You agree not to, and not to allow third parties or Your End Users, to use the Services:
  1. to generate or facilitate unsolicited bulk commercial email
  2. to violate, or encourage the violation of, the legal rights of others
  3. for any unlawful, invasive, infringing, defamatory, or fraudulent purpose
  4. to intentionally distribute viruses, worms, Trojan horses, corrupted files, hoaxes, or other items of a destructive or deceptive nature
  5. to interfere with the use of the Services, or the equipment used to provide the Services, by customers, authorized resellers, or other authorized users
  6. to alter, disable, interfere with or circumvent any aspect of the Services
  7. to test or reverse-engineer the Services in order to find limitations, vulnerabilities or evade filtering capabilities
Failure to comply with the AUP may result in suspension or termination, or both, of the Services pursuant to the Agreement. BPM reserves the right to place a daily cap on the number of End-User outbound emails sent within a 24 hour period. This cap is currently set at 1000. Customer can apply for cap to be temporarily removed by contacting Support.
